What makes a great preschool program?

1. Developmentally appropriate, play-based learning
The best preschool balances play with purposeful learning. Look for classrooms where hands-on activities, sensory play, and exploratory centers are central. These experiences help children develop language, early math skills, fine motor control, and problem-solving abilities — all while having fun.

2. Qualified, caring teachers
A warm teacher who understands early childhood development is priceless. Teachers should be trained in early childhood education, be attentive to individual needs, and foster a respectful, encouraging classroom environment. Positive interactions and responsive caregiving build secure attachments and social-emotional growth.

3. Strong focus on social and emotional skills
Preschool is where children learn to share, take turns, manage emotions, and form friendships. The best preschool programs intentionally teach social skills through guided activities, storytelling, and collaborative play, helping children develop empathy and resilience.

4. A predictable routine with flexibility
Young children thrive on routines that provide security — consistent meal times, rest, group activities, and outdoor play. At the same time, the best preschools allow flexibility for curiosity and child-led discoveries so learning stays engaging and meaningful.

5. Safe, healthy, and stimulating environment
Safety is nonnegotiable. Classrooms and outdoor play areas should be clean, age-appropriate, and well-organized. Stimulating materials — books, art supplies, blocks, and dramatic play props — encourage creativity and cognitive growth.

6. Family partnership and communication
A quality preschool keeps parents in the loop with regular communication, progress updates, and opportunities to participate. When families and teachers work together, children benefit from consistent support across home and school environments.

7. Kindergarten readiness without pressure
The goal of a top preschool is to prepare children for kindergarten academically and socially — not to rush formal schooling. Look for programs that cultivate early literacy, numeracy, curiosity, and independence through developmentally appropriate activities.
